Target your quads and hamstrings with smooth, controlled reps—all from one seated position. The Leg Extension and Curl Machine V2 is built to help you strengthen your lower body without wasting time or compromising form.
Perfect for home gyms, this plate-loaded machine makes it easy to switch between leg extensions and seated hamstring curls with a quick pull of the adjustment pin. The rotary leg clamp locks your legs in place, while the adjustable foot roller fits users of all sizes.
Padded with durable HeftyGrip Vinyl, it's easy to clean and built to last through intense leg days.

I wanted something to replace the "pain in the ass" bench leg attachments and this machine fits the bill. The stop pin isn't used making transitions between exercises easier. The upper leg roller needs more clearance. That being said,we like this machine.

Easy to assemble, well designed. My only issue has to do with the stiffness of the pad vs. sensitivity of my shins during extensions. Workaround: wrap towel around pad fastened with wide rubber bands. Works fine that way

A nice machine for the price. Takes a bit of time to figure out settting and the one end point or the other isn't "loaded" since it's a gravity driven machine but for the price it's a great addition for a home gym.
